What is a punch list carpenter?

Punch List Carpenters are skilled tradespeople responsible for completing final finishing tasks on construction projects. They address items on a 'punch list,' which is a document listing work that needs to be completed or corrected before a project is considered finished. Their duties often include fixing minor issues like adjusting doors, patching drywall, installing hardware, or touching up paint. Punch List Carpenters help ensure the final quality of a build meets the client's standards and all specifications are satisfied before handover. Their attention to detail is crucial for delivering a polished and fully functional finished product.

What are some common challenges faced by punch list carpenters when completing final project inspections?

Punch List Carpenters often encounter the challenge of managing tight deadlines while ensuring high-quality workmanship on last-minute fixes. They must coordinate closely with project managers, subcontractors, and inspectors to address any deficiencies identified during final walkthroughs. Attention to detail is critical, as even minor oversights can delay project completion or client sign-off. Flexibility and strong problem-solving skills are essential, as each project may present unique issues that require creative solutions.

What is the difference between Punch List Carpenter vs Finish Carpenter?

AspectPunch List CarpenterFinish Carpenter
CredentialsHigh school diploma, on-the-job trainingHigh school diploma, apprenticeship or vocational training
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, renovation projectsInterior spaces, new builds, remodeling
Employer & IndustryConstruction companies, contractorsCarpentry firms, general contractors
Primary FocusIdentifying and fixing defects, completing punch listsInstalling and finishing interior carpentry elements

In summary, Punch List Carpenters focus on inspecting and completing punch list items to ensure construction quality, while Finish Carpenters specialize in installing and finishing interior woodwork. Both roles require carpentry skills but differ in their primary responsibilities and work stages.
